This study examines the population density and growth trends in zip code 45439, located in Moraine, Ohio. The data indicates that this area is classified as a suburban environment based on its population density. In 2022, the population density was approximately 1,414 people per square mile, which is within the typical range for suburban areas.
The population data from 2010 to 2022 shows a pattern of modest growth. The number of residents increased from 10,676 in 2010 to 11,522 in 2022. This represents a gradual increase in population over the twelve-year period, suggesting a slow but consistent development trend in the area.
The housing data for 2022 estimates 4,415 housing units in the zip code, with an average household size of 2.61 people. This information indicates that the area primarily consists of family-oriented residences and established community members.
